Abstract

A biological affinities study based on frequencies of cranial nonmetric traits in skeletal samples from three cemeteries at predynastic Naqada, Egypt, confirms the results of a recent nonmetric dental morphological analysis. Both cranial and dental traits analyses indicate that the individuals buried in a cemetery characterized archaeologically as high status are significantly different from individuals buried in two other, apparently nonelite cemeteries and that the nonelite samples are not significantly different from each other. A comparison with neighbouring Nile Valley skeletal samples suggests that the high status cemetery represents an endogamous ruling or elite segment of the local population at Naqada, which is more closely related to populations in northern Nubia than to neighbouring populations in southern Egypt.

摘要

一项基于埃及前王朝时期纳卡达三座墓地骨骼样本中颅骨非测量性状频率的生物亲缘关系研究,证实了近期一项非测量牙齿形态分析的结果。颅骨和牙齿性状分析均表明,埋葬在一个考古学上被认定为高地位墓地的个体,与埋葬在另外两个明显非精英墓地的个体存在显著差异,且非精英样本之间没有显著差异。与邻近尼罗河流域骨骼样本的比较表明,高地位墓地代表了纳卡达当地人口中一个实行族内通婚的统治阶层或精英群体,该群体与努比亚北部的人群关系更为密切,而非与埃及南部的邻近人群关系密切。
